Make sure you’re betting on teams with good odds
The most important rule when betting on a game is to check the odds at multiple sportsbooks. This is crucial for finding the best odds and lines, which can help you maximize your winnings and cut your losses.
Set your fandom aside
While it’s fun to bet on your favorite team or player, don’t let it influence your decisions. You may be tempted to put your money on an underdog that has the better uniforms or is more talented, but those aren’t necessarily the most sound bets.
